New Patient Forms; In 1868 Foster gave a speech to a handful of pioneers gathered on Minnesota Point to celebrate Independence Day, during which he laid out a vision of future Duluth, which he called the Zenith City of the Unsalted Seas. Soon thereafter, Foster's statement became Duluth's unofficial nickname and was adopted by many The legend of the digging of Duluths ship canal, that 100 stout men shoveled it out in 48 hours, is just one of many myths surrounding the Zenith City. Winnemac is a fictional U.S. state invented by the writer Sinclair Lewis.His novel Babbitt takes place in Zenith, its largest city (population 361,000, according to a sketch-map Lewis made to guide his writing).Winnemac is also a setting for Gideon Planish, Arrowsmith, Elmer Gantry, and Dodsworth On this day in what would become Duluth in 1868 at an Independence Day picnic on Minnesota Point, Dr. Thomas Fosterwho produced Duluths first paper, the Minnesotiangave a grand oration, during which he first called Duluth the Zenith City of the Unsalted Seas and outlined the future of Duluth as the Chicago of Lake Superior. It was a speech filled with optimism; in January 1869 just fourteen families lived at the base of Minnesota Point. But it's equally true that there were times when its fortunes were not so manifest. In 1869, Duluth was the fastest growing city in the United States, and it was on track to becoming the largest city in the Midwest. In it, Foster describes a network of rail lines that would turn Duluth into a mecca for commerce, as from the Atlantic to the Pacific, all roads would lead to Duluth, and they would offer the cheapest and most expeditious route into the streets of our Zenith City of the Unsalted Seas., This grainy image is the only known photograph of Dr. Thomas Foster, editor of the Duluth Minnesotian, made February 15, 1870, during the groundbreaking for the Northern Pacific Railroad. Thomas Foster founded the Daily Minnesotian ("Minne-so-shun") in 1869 after essentially moving his St. Paul Minnesotian to what would soon become Duluth.
